Catholics invited to answer questions about family life

All Catholics are invited to respond to an online questionnaire related to family life in preparation for the XIV Ordinary General Synod of Bishops set for October. The answers will help guide Archbishop Joseph E. Kurtz and other prelates taking part in the meeting.

Following the 2014 Synod of Bishops on the family, which looked at the topic “The Pastoral Challenges of the Family in the Context of Evangelization,” Pope Francis released a summary called the Lineamenta, or preparatory document. It includes a series of questions aimed at determining how the document has been received and to examine the work started by the October 2014 Synod.

The results of this questionnaire, along with the Lineamenta, will serve as the starting point for the Instrumentum Laboris, the working document for the October 2015 XIV Ordinary General Synod. The fall meeting will examine “The Vocation and Mission of the Family in the Church and the Contemporary World.”

The questionnaire is available at www.archlou.org/Synod2015. Respondents are encouraged to review the questions and answer only those that seem most important. A Spanish version is also available. Responses are due by March 7.
